Roach Control in Ridgecrest, FL

Roach calls in Ridgecrest almost always start in the kitchen or bathroom, and by the time they're visible during the day, the population is usually well established behind walls and under appliances. We treat with gel bait and targeted crack-and-crevice application rather than a visible spray, because that's what actually breaks the breeding cycle. German roaches in particular can maintain an indoor population in Ridgecrest year-round once established, since they rely on warm, moist indoor microclimates rather than outdoor conditions.

Bed Bug Treatment in Ridgecrest, FL

Bed bugs in Ridgecrest don't care how clean a home is -- they travel in luggage, used furniture, and shared laundry facilities, which is why we see them in every part of Pinellas County, not just older housing. Our treatment combines heat and targeted chemical application because bed bugs have grown resistant to many sprays used alone. Prevention checklist for Ridgecrest homes

One quick habit for each pest we cover here -- the full guide for each service has a longer checklist.

  • Raccoon Removal: Keep compost bins secured with a locking lid rather than an open pile, especially if it's within a few feet of the house.
  • Skunk Removal: If you see a skunk during the day, keep pets inside and stay back -- daytime activity can (though doesn't always) signal illness.
  • Mosquito Control: Add or maintain fish in any decorative pond; mosquitofish and many common pond fish eat larvae before they mature.
  • Rat Control: Address clutter in garages, sheds, and basements -- rats prefer nesting sites with cover, and stacked boxes or stored materials give them exactly that.
  • Roach Control: Store food, including pet food, in sealed containers rather than the original packaging.
  • Bed Bug Treatment: When traveling, check hotel mattress seams and headboards, and keep luggage off the bed and floor when possible.
